I like happy endings in my films

Although he is known as a realist director making films on 'serious issues', writer- cum director Nagesh Kukunoor personally favours fairytale endings as he says they are far more appealing than negative ones.

Kukunoor is famous for his out-of-league films like 'Hyderabad Blues', 'Iqbal' and 'Dor' which talk about the importance of hope, love, friendship and inspiration in difficult times.

"I like happy endings in my films. Though I do not try to give any sort of message in them but if in the process of telling the story I am able to inspire someone, that's good, " he says.
